David Vladimirovitch Ashkenazi (Russian: Дави́д Влади́мирович Ашкена́зи; 25 December 1915 – 19 February 1997) was a Russian-Jewish pianist, accompanist and composer. Ashkenazi was born on 25 December 1915 in Nizhny Novgorod. He studied piano at the local music college and at the Moscow Conservatory. He worked as an accompanist with a number of celebrated Soviet pop singers, including , Klavdiya Shulzhenko, Lyudmila Zykina, Marina Gordon, Vadim Kozin, Mark Bernes, Iosif Kobzon and others. He was made People's Artist of Russia in 1996. He died on 19 February 1997 in Moscow, Russia.
